Output 71f38bb6233b1785562a6da98b6169a71a17e6d3f41111b99a812582ad900bb6:2

value
13986058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47615a523398d80a98c4447726a4bb7cbd1995cd OP_EQUAL
address
38CSXMbsFsvBhn22wkefJHzAGwVuUNqFiG
transaction
71f38bb6233b1785562a6da98b6169a71a17e6d3f41111b99a812582ad900bb6
spent
true